markm wrote:I see 'lime green in your signature, so is that your chosen colour?
Yeah, I've settled on Lime Green.

This is a photograph of ‘Limey’, a well know UK, Lime Green Carrera.
I took this picture at Classic Le Mans some years back when I had my Metallic Green 2.4S.
The CLM organisers held a Concours D’Elegance and I was delighted to be awarded a prize for the 2.4 when it was deemed to be the second best early 911 on the day.
The car that won the overall award for Best Car was Nigel’s Lime Green Carrera (although no longer Nigel’s).
In all honesty I felt there were better quality cars present and yet their owners took away no silverware.
And I then realised two things: the ’74 Carrera is a well regarded car but more importantly Lime Green looks fabulous.
It stole the heart of the judges. And I guess it resonated within me too. Such things can shape your life.
Anyway, I’m close to owning a similar car now and I’m really looking forward to it. 8)
